Lamborne Alms-house. Conclus.
HODIE 3a
vice lecta est Billa, An Act concerning
the Hospital of Lamborne, quæ communi omnium Procerum Assensu conclusa est, et data Servienti Puckeringe,
in Domum Communem deferenda.
Exportstion of Cloth. Expedit.
Hodie 3a
vice lecta est Billa, An Act for the better
Execution of the Statute, made in the Eighth Year of
the Queen's Majesty's Reign, touching Cloth-workers,
and Cloths to be shipped over the Seas, quæ communi
omnium Procerum Assensu conclusa est.
Forcible Entries. Commiss.
Item 2a
vice lecta est Billa, An Act of Exemplification of the Statute of 8° Regis Henrici Sexti, concerning
forcible Entries, the Indictments thereupon found, quæ
commissa est.
Ejectione Firmæ. Commiss.
Item 2a
vice lecta est Billa, An Act for Ejectione
Firmæ, quæ commissa est.
Hodie allatæ * sunt a Domo Communi 3 Billæ:
Exigents in Durham. Expedit.
Prima, An Act for Writs upon Proclamations and
Exigents to be current within the County Palatine of
Durham.
Joyce Lambert.
Secunda, An Act for Naturalizing of Joyce the
Daughter of Raulfe Elkine, Gentleman, and Wife of
Richard Lambert, Merchant, born beyond the Seas.
Repeal of Laws.
Tertia, An Act for the Repeal of certain Statutes,
quæ 1a
vice lecta est.
Adjourn.
Dominus Cancellarius continuavit præsens Parliamentum usque in diem crastinum, hora consueta.
